Career Roles | Key Responsibilities |
---|---|
Maintenance Planner | Developing maintenance schedules and plans |
Maintenance Scheduler | Coordinating maintenance activities and resources |
Reliability Engineer | Analyzing equipment performance data |
Asset Manager | Optimizing asset lifecycle costs |
Maintenance Coordinator | Ensuring timely completion of maintenance tasks |
